Many residents search for a “truck accident settlement calculator in Pittsburg, KS” because they want a quick range. But truck claims don’t follow a simple formula—especially when the case involves:
- Shared responsibility (driver, trucking company, employer practices)
- Disputes about injury cause (what’s related to the crash vs. what isn’t)
- Evidence that can disappear (dash/event data, maintenance records, log information)
- Coverage limits tied to commercial policies, not just standard auto insurance
In practical terms: two people can have similar injuries and still see different outcomes depending on documentation, timing of treatment, and how clearly fault is supported.
